Java_Tag标签_程序员俱乐部

中国优秀的程序员网站程序员频道CXYCLUB技术地图
热搜:
更多>>
 
当前位置:程序员俱乐部 >>Tag标签 >> Java >>列表
英文原文:Top5BestToolstoConvertJavatoC#SourceCode毋庸置疑,Java是一门最受欢迎而且使用最广泛的编程语言,目前有超过9百万的Java开发者从事web服务的开发,Java以“编写一次,可在任何地方运行”而著称,同时这也是其大受欢迎的主要原因。和Java类似,C#也是一门拥有很多现代化特性的编程语言,很多开发者处于其安全性和稳定性,会选择C#这个平台。本文介绍了几个最优秀的Java和C#代码转换工具,希望对开发者有所帮助。1... 查看全文
· 反射,代理,动态java原理发布时间:2014-12-22
需要两个类,用于下面的测试packagetest;publicinterfaceIProcess{publicvoidprocess();}packagetest;publicclassProcessimplementsIProcess{publicvoidprocess(){System.out.println("实际处理器开始执行!");}}反射的例子,forName方法//根据classname来生成对象动态加载jar的方式类似privatestaticclassJarLoader... 查看全文
· 谷歌开源Cloud Dataflow Java SDK发布时间:2014-12-22
英文原文:GoogleOpenSourcesCloudDataflowJavaSDK今年早些时候,谷歌宣布了CloudDataflow,一个批量或实时处理海量数据的服务和SDK。现在,他们开源了DataflowJavaSDK,使开发人员可以看到它的实现方式,并合理使用该SDK开发运行在本地或其它云上的服务。Dataflow是一项云服务,使用了由FlumeJava和MillWheel演变而来的技术,前者是一个用于创建数据并行管道的Java库,后者是一个用于构建容错流处理应用的框架... 查看全文
· java,list转数组发布时间:2014-12-21
List<String>list=newArrayList<String>();if(id!=null&&!"".equals(id)){sb.append("andtw.id=?");list.add(id);}if(memo!=null&&!"".equals(memo)){sb.append("andtw.memolike?");list.add("%"+memo+"%");}sb.append("orderbytw.iddesc"... 查看全文
· javascript 闭包的理解发布时间:2014-12-21
看过很多谈如何理解闭包的方法,但大多数文章,都是照抄或者解释《Javascript高级程序设计(第三版)》对于闭包的讲解,甚至例程都不约而同的引用高程三181页‘闭包与变量’一节的那个“返回数组各个项,结果各个项的值都相同”的例程,还有些文章的讲解过程上一步与下一步之间的跨度简直就是一步登天,让人反复看半天都无法理解。闭包的理解需要很多概念做铺垫,包括变量作用域链、执行环境、变量活动对象、引用式垃圾内存收集机制等,如果对本文涉及的这些概念不理解... 查看全文
· 5步避免Java堆空间错误发布时间:2014-12-20
牢记以下五个步骤可以为你减少很多头痛的问题并且避免Java堆空间错误。通过计算预期的内存消耗。检查JVM是否有足够的可用空间。检查JVM的设置是否正确。限制节点使用交换空间和内存分页。设置实例slot数量小于JobTrackerwebGUI计算的数值。译者注:slot:slot不是CPU的Core,也不是memorychip,它是一个逻辑概念,一个节点的slot的数量用来表示某个节点的资源的容量或者说是能力的大小,因而slot是Hadoop的资源单位。详见这里。在这篇博文里... 查看全文
· java中常用的类型转换发布时间:2014-12-19
1.将字符串转换成整数(String--->int)方法一:(1)inti=Integer.parseInt(Strings);其中(1)其实就是我们经常用到的将s转换为10进制得数,其实默认是调用了inti=Integer.parseInt("123",10);(2)i=Integer.parseInt(Strings,intradix);radix的范围是在2~36之间,超出范围会抛异常。其中s的长度也不能超出7,否则也会抛异常。方法二:inti=Integer.valueOf... 查看全文
英文原文:LibscoreTracksWhichJavaScriptLibrariesAretheMostPopular开发者朱利安·夏皮罗和托马斯·戴维斯已经开始了一项新的在线服务,名字叫做Libscore跟踪JavaScript库和脚本的受欢迎程度,“每个月,它都会根据alexa.com上的流量排名爬到访问量最高的百万个我给你占上去,一旦整个扫描开始运行,它需要约38个小时,然后我们会汇总数据,并把它公布出来,任何人都可以在Libscore... 查看全文
· java文件操作发布时间:2014-12-19
packagecom.swt.common.util;importjava.io.BufferedInputStream;importjava.io.BufferedOutputStream;importjava.io.BufferedWriter;importjava.io.File;importjava.io.FileInputStream;importjava.io.FileNotFoundException;importjava.io.FileOutputStream... 查看全文
· java join的用法发布时间:2014-12-19
转自http://blog.csdn.net/anhuixiaozi/article/details/4548679join的用法,先看几个例子在说。程序1:publicclassThreadTestimplementsRunnable{publicstaticinta=0;publicsynchronizedvoidinc(){a++;}publicvoidrun(){for(inti=0;i<5;i++){inc();}}publicstaticvoidmain... 查看全文
· 例说java枚举类型发布时间:2014-12-18
实例解读java枚举类型:packagecom.ljq.test;/***枚举用法详解**@authorjiqinlin**/publicclassTestEnum{/***普通枚举**@authorjiqinlin**/publicenumColorEnum{red,green,yellow,blue;}/***枚举像普通的类一样可以添加属性和方法,可以为它添加静态和非静态的属性或方法**@authorjiqinlin**/publicenumSeasonEnum{//注:枚举写在最前面... 查看全文
· Java session学习发布时间:2014-12-18
今天项目中突然要使用Session,以前也没怎么用过,于是在网上搜索了一番,然后从各大神的资料中摘抄了一些一、Session的生命周期Session存储在服务器端,一般为了防止在服务器的内存中(为了高速存取),Sessinon在用户访问第一次访问服务器时创建,需要注意只有访问JSP、Servlet等程序时才会创建Session,只访问HTML、IMAGE等静态资源并不会创建Session,可调用request.getSession(true)强制生成Session。Session什么时候失效... 查看全文
http://it.deepinmind.com/jvm/2014/12/15/self-healing-jvm.html这里说了一个观点,叫做JVM的自愈能力,就是说JVM在遇到问题时会自己发现问题解决问题,举例如下:packageeu.plumbr.test;publicclassHealMe{privatestaticfinalintSIZE=(int)(Runtime.getRuntime().maxMemory()*0.6);publicstaticvoidmain... 查看全文
· java导出excel表格发布时间:2014-12-18
List<PhoneLogDto>list=newArrayList<T>();//换成数据源response.setContentType("application/msexcel");response.setHeader("Content-disposition","attachment;filename=name.xls");//设定输出文件名称OutputStreamos=response.getOutputStream()... 查看全文
· java 读取properties 配置文件发布时间:2014-12-18
privatestaticfinalStringFILENAME="dll/service.properties";privatestaticPropertiesproperties=null;//静态块static{properties=newProperties();InputStreamin=null;try{//读取服务文件in=newFileInputStream(FILENAME);properties.load(in);}catch(IOExceptione)... 查看全文
· java 使用Runtime 打开浏览器发布时间:2014-12-18
publicstaticvoidmain(Stringargs[]){try{//不是在Java程序中执行而是在操作系统中执行//Runtime.getRuntime().exec("cmd/cstarthttp://lqi.iteye.com/");Runtime.getRuntime().exec("explorer\"http://lqi.iteye.com\"");}catch(IOExceptione){//TODOAuto-generatedcatchblocke... 查看全文
· java中的日期加一个月的计算发布时间:2014-12-18
Calendarcalendar=Calendar.getInstance();calendar.setTime(date);calendar.add(Calendar.MONTH,1);System.out.println("增加月份后的日期:"+calendar.getTime());... 查看全文
· Java获取随机不重复的数得值发布时间:2014-12-18
假如我有一个数组:ArrayList<Integer>mArrayList=newArrayList<Integer>();mArrayList.add(0);mArrayList.add(1);mArrayList.add(2);mArrayList.add(3);我需要从中随机抽取2个数不能重复抽取,我就会用这个方法publicvoidgetValue(ArrayList<Integer>mArrayList)... 查看全文
最近在研究JAVA的数据源连接方式,学习的时候发现了一位同行写的文章,转载过来,留作记录!一、问题引入在java程序中,需要访问数据库,做增删改查等相关操作。如何访问数据库,做数据库的相关操作呢?二、Java连接数据库方法概述java.sql提供了一些接口和类,用于支持数据库增删改查等相关的操作。该jar包定义了java访问各种不同数据库(mysql,oracle,sqlserver。。。。。)的统一接口和标准。同时,各个数据库厂商都提供了该jar包中定义的各个接口的实现类... 查看全文
一、简介Exchanger是自jdk1.5起开始提供的工具套件,一般用于两个工作线程之间交换数据。在本文中我将采取由浅入深的方式来介绍分析这个工具类。首先我们来看看官方的api文档中的叙述:Asynchronizationpointatwhichthreadscanpairandswapelementswithinpairs.Eachthreadpresentssomeobjectonentrytotheexchangemethod,matcheswithapartnerthread... 查看全文